MySQL性能调优:高效查询优化策略深度剖析

MySQL性能调优是数据库管理中的关键环节,直接影响系统响应速度和用户体验。高效查询优化能够减少资源消耗,提升整体运行效率。

索引是优化查询的核心工具。合理使用索引可以大幅缩短数据检索时间,但过多或不当的索引会增加写入开销。应根据查询条件和排序需求,选择合适的字段建立索引。

避免全表扫描是优化的重要目标。通过分析执行计划(EXPLAIN),可以识别未使用索引的查询,并进行调整。例如,避免在WHERE子句中对字段进行函数操作,以免导致索引失效。

查询语句的编写也影响性能。应尽量避免使用SELECT ,而是指定需要的字段。同时,合理使用JOIN操作,避免不必要的关联,减少数据传输量。

数据库结构设计同样不可忽视。规范化与反规范化的平衡有助于提高查询效率,合理划分表结构能减少冗余,提升查询速度。

AI绘图结果,仅供参考

定期清理无用数据、优化表结构、调整配置参数,也是保持MySQL高性能的重要手段。结合实际业务场景,持续监控和调整,才能实现长期稳定运行。

dawei

发表回复